The design of a knife’s tip considerably influences how you use it every day. Whether you’re chopping vegetables, slicing meat, or peeling fruit, the tip’s shape and functionality can make a noticeable difference in your efficiency and safety. When choosing a knife, paying attention to the tip design helps guarantee you get the best performance for your needs. For instance, a pointed tip allows for precise piercing and intricate cuts, which is essential when working with small ingredients or decorative garnishes. Conversely, a rounded or blunt tip might be safer for general kitchen tasks, especially if you’re less experienced or cooking with children nearby. Your choice impacts not just your technique but also your comfort and confidence in handling the knife.

Blade durability is another essential factor tied closely to the tip design. A sturdy, well-made blade maintains its edge longer, making your daily tasks smoother and more consistent. When the tip is reinforced or designed with high-quality materials, it resists chipping or bending, even when you apply pressure. This durability guarantees that you won’t need to replace or sharpen your knife as frequently, saving you time and money. A durable blade with a robust tip also allows for more aggressive piercing or cutting without fear of damaging the tool. Over time, a resilient design proves invaluable in maintaining your confidence in the knife, especially when tackling tougher ingredients or more demanding culinary tasks. How Does Tip Design Affect Overall Knife Durability?
The tip design greatly impacts your knife’s durability by influencing blade ergonomics and material resilience. A sturdy, well-crafted tip reduces stress concentration, preventing chips or breakage during tough tasks. If the tip is too delicate or poorly integrated, it can weaken the overall blade, leading to faster wear. Choosing a design that balances precision with strength ensures your knife withstands daily use, maintaining performance and extending its lifespan.
